Scope 3 emissions are indirect gre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ions that occur in a company's value chain, including both upstream and downstream activities. These emissions are a result of the company's business activities but occur outside of its operational control. Scope 3 emissions can include emissions from suppliers, transportation, use of products by customers, and disposal of products at the end of their useful life.

Scope 3 emissions are often the largest source of emissions for many companies and can be challenging to measure and manage due to their complexity and the involvement of external stakeholders. However, companies are increasingly recognizing the importance of addressing their Scope 3 emissions as part of their climate change mitigation strategies, as they represent a significant opportunity to reduce their overall carbon footprint and contribute to a more sustainable future.
